Privacy By Design
Privacy by Design is a concept that promotes building privacy protections into the design and architecture of products, services, and systems from the outset. It involves considering privacy implications at every stage of development, ensuring that personal data is protected by default.
Example #1
An example of Privacy by Design is when a social media platform incorporates privacy features like end-to-end encryption into its messaging service, ensuring that user conversations are secure and protected from unauthorized access.
Example #2
Another example is a healthcare app that limits the collection of unnecessary personal data and implements strong data encryption protocols to safeguard patient information.

Benefits
The benefits of Privacy by Design include enhancing user trust, promoting data security, and fostering compliance with privacy regulations. By embedding privacy protections into the core of their offerings, businesses can demonstrate their commitment to user privacy and build stronger relationships with customers. Additionally, adhering to Privacy by Design principles can reduce the likelihood of data breaches and regulatory penalties, benefiting both businesses and consumers.
